The Leeza Soho Tower with a total area of 172800 square meters is the latest collaboration between Zaha Hadid Architecture (ZHD) and Soho China Company. The tower, with a height of 207 meters and 47 floors, is located in the heart of Beijing and is scheduled to be completed by September 2018.
This tower is divided into two parts, and the new metro tunnels in Beijing passes through both sides of the tower.
As the tower's height increases, the rotation of the tower's main structure increases and the rotation angle reach 45 degrees, expanding the amount of natural light entered, and creating a good view of each floor and for each unit.
In the center of the building, there are hallways for business offices that connect two parts of the building at the height of 190-meter, which will be the "tallest atrium in the world".
The prominent architect of the project, Zaha Hadid, had designed the tower, based on environmental and time conditions, to reduce building energy consumption and emit greenhouse gases.
